Choosing the Right Wire Rope: Factors to Consider

When it comes to selecting selecting the ideal wire rope for your application, several key factors must be carefully considered. First and foremost, you'll need to determine the intended load requirements. This involves considering the burden that the rope will be lifting on a regular basis.

Next, consider the functional environment in which the rope will be used. Will it be exposed to severe temperatures, moisture, or corrosive substances? Understanding these circumstances will help you choose a rope made from the appropriate materials and with the required protective coatings.

Finally, think about the type of application. Different ropes are designed for specific purposes.

For instance, a wire rope used for building will likely have different properties than one used in a oceanic setting.
